Рак кожи, включая меланому, базалиому и плоскоклеточный рак, является одним из наиболее распространенных онкологических заболеваний в мире. Несмотря на глобальные усилия, его профилактика и ранняя диагностика остаются недостаточно эффективными, что приводит к высокой смертности, особенно в регионах с высокой инсоляцией и среди населения с I-II фототипом кожи.</p></sec><sec><title>Цель работы</title><p>Цель работы. Данное исследование направлено на поиск и систематизацию путей повышения результативности профилактических мероприятий и скрининговых программ в отношении рака кожи и предраковых состояний, особенно среди групп высокого риска. Конечная цель – разработка практических рекомендаций для снижения показателей заболеваемости и летальности на популяционном уровне.</p></sec><sec><title>Материалы и методы</title><p>Материалы и методы. В работе проанализированы данные репрезентативных когортных исследований и регистров заболеваемости раком кожи в разных странах за период с 2010 по 2023 гг. Методами систематического обзора и метаанализа оценена эффективность различных подходов к профилактике (солнцезащитное поведение) и раннему выявлению новообразований. Результаты. Результаты показали, что наиболее эффективными являются комплексные многокомпонентные профилактические программы. Они включают образовательные кампании в СМИ и соцсетях, регулярный скрининг групп риска с привлечением терапевтов и использование современных неинвазивных методов диагностики. Предложенный алгоритм risk-based-скрининга, основанный на шкале оценки риска, позволяет на 18-23% повысить выявляемость новообразований на ранних стадиях (p &lt; 0,05), сокращая число запущенных случаев.</p></sec><sec><title>Заключение</title><p>Заключение. Таким образом, сделан вывод о критической необходимости внедрения дифференцированного подхода к профилактике и ранней диагностике рака кожи с учетом индивидуального риска. Это позволит не только оптимизировать финансовые и кадровые ресурсы здравоохранения, но и значимо улучшить прогноз и выживаемость пациентов.</p></sec></abstract><trans-abstract xml:lang="en"><sec><title>Background</title><p>Background. Skin cancer is one of the most common cancers in the world, but its prevention and early diagnosis remain insufficiently effective.</p></sec><sec><title>Objective</title><p>Objective. This research aims to find ways to improve the effectiveness of prevention and screening programs for skin cancer and precancerous conditions, especially among high-risk groups.</p></sec><sec><title>Materials and methods</title><p>Materials and methods. The work analyzed data on the incidence and mortality from skin cancer in different countries for the period from 2010 to 2023, and assessed various approaches to the prevention and early detection of skin tumors.</p><p>The results showed that the most effective are comprehensive preventive programs, including education of the population, regular screening of risk groups, and the use of modern non-invasive diagnostic methods. A risk-based skin cancer screening algorithm has been proposed, which allows for an 18-23% increase in the detection of tumors in the early stages (p &lt; 0.05).</p></sec><sec><title>Conclusion</title><p>Conclusion. It is concluded that a differentiated approach to the prevention and early diagnosis of skin cancer is necessary, taking into account individual risk.</p></sec></trans-abstract><kwd-group xml:lang="ru"><kwd>рак кожи</kwd><kwd>профилактика</kwd><kwd>ранняя диагностика</kwd><kwd>скрининг</kwd><kwd>группы риска</kwd><kwd>дерматоскопия</kwd><kwd>спектрофотометрический интрадермальный анализ</kwd></kwd-group><kwd-group xml:lang="en"><kwd>skin cancer</kwd><kwd>prevention</kwd><kwd>early diagnosis</kwd><kwd>screening</kwd><kwd>risk groups</kwd><kwd>dermatoscopy</kwd><kwd>spectrophotometric intradermal analysis</kwd></kwd-group></article-meta></front><back><ref-list><title>References</title><ref id="cit1"><label>1</label><citation-alternatives><mixed-citation xml:lang="ru">Bhullar S., Christensen S.
